-
Java超市收银系统开发全攻略:功能实现与性能优化
Java超市收银系统开发指南:从零搭建高效零售管理平台 一、超市收银系统的核心价值与Java技术优势 在现代零售业中,高效的收银系统是提升运营效率的关键。一个优秀的Java超市收银系统能够实现: 快速商品扫码识别 精准价格计算 多样化支付方式集成 实时库存更新 销售数据分析 Java语言因其跨平台性、稳定性和丰富的生态系统,成为开发商业级收银系统的首选。Java的强类型检查和异常处理机制特别适合需要高可靠性的金融交易场景。二、系统架构设计 2.1 三层架构实现 我们采用经典...
作者:admin 日期:2025.06.27 分类:Java安全 19 -
深入理解Java方法:语法结构到设计模式的全面指南
在Java编程语言中,方法是构建程序逻辑的基本单元,也是面向对象编程的核心组成部分。本文将全面解析Java方法的各个方面,从基础概念到高级应用,帮助开发者掌握这一关键编程要素。一、Java方法的基本概念 Java方法(Method)是一段为了完成特定功能而定义的代码块,它可以接收输入参数并返回处理结果。方法的主要作用包括: 1. 代码复用:避免重复编写相同功能的代码 2. 模块化编程:将复杂问题分解为多个小问题 3. 提高可读性:通过方法名直观表达代码意图二、Java方法的语...
作者:admin 日期:2025.06.27 分类:Java安全 16 -
Java开发者必备:2023最新Java生态全景解析与最佳实践
Java作为全球最流行的编程语言之一,其"一次编写,到处运行"的特性彻底改变了软件开发的方式。本文将带您深入探索Java语言的方方面面,从基础语法到高级特性,全面解析这个经久不衰的编程语言。第一章:Java语言基础入门 Java语言的基础语法是每个开发者的必经之路。我们首先从最基础的数据类型开始: 八大基本数据类型:byte、short、int、long、float、double、char、boolean 引用数据类型:类、接口、数组 变量与常量的声明与使用 控制结构是程序...
作者:admin 日期:2025.06.27 分类:Java安全 18 -
Java开发者必备:MySQL数据库连接、CRUD操作与异常处理全解析
在当今的软件开发中,Java与MySQL的组合是最流行的技术栈之一。本文将全面讲解Java连接MySQL的各种方法,从基础配置到高级优化,帮助开发者构建高效可靠的数据库连接。一、环境准备与基础配置 在开始之前,我们需要确保开发环境已经准备好。首先需要安装Java开发环境(JDK)和MySQL数据库。推荐使用JDK 8或以上版本,MySQL 5.7或8.0版本。1.1 下载MySQL Connector/J MySQL官方提供了专门的Java驱动程序Connector/J,这是...
作者:admin 日期:2025.06.27 分类:Java安全 19 -
紧急修复指南:7步彻底消除Java应用程序被阻止的安全警告
当您尝试运行某个Java应用程序时,突然弹出'应用程序已被Java安全阻止'的警告窗口,这种情况可能让许多用户感到困惑和沮丧。本文将深入分析这一问题的根源,并提供7种专业级的解决方案,帮助您彻底摆脱这个困扰。一、错误产生的深层原因 Java从7u51版本开始引入了更严格的安全机制,当出现以下情况时就会触发这个警告: 应用程序未使用有效的数字证书签名 应用程序签名证书已过期或被吊销 Java安全级别设置为'高'或'非常高' 应用程序来自不受信任的发布者 JAR文件清单属性不完整...
作者:admin 日期:2025.06.27 分类:Java安全 22 -
避开盗版陷阱!我的世界Java版正版下载与模组安装终极指南
在沙盒游戏领域,《我的世界》(Minecraft)始终占据着不可撼动的地位。其中Java版因其强大的模组支持和高自由度备受核心玩家推崇。本文将全面解析Java版的下载安装全流程,帮助新老玩家安全便捷地开启方块世界之旅。一、Java版与基岩版的本质区别 1. 跨平台特性对比:Java版仅支持Windows/macOS/Linux,而基岩版覆盖移动端和主机平台 2. 模组生态差异:Java版支持Forge/Fabric等成熟模组框架,可玩性高出数个量级 3. 红石机制差异:Jav...
作者:admin 日期:2025.06.27 分类:Java安全 23 -
Java文件处理大全:新手必学、老手优化的获取技巧
在Java编程中,文件操作是最基础也是最重要的技能之一。无论是读取配置文件、处理日志文件,还是进行数据持久化,都离不开文件操作。本文将全面介绍Java中获取文件的7种专业方法,帮助开发者掌握从基础到高阶的文件处理技巧。一、使用java.io.File类(传统方法) File类是Java最早提供的文件操作类,虽然现在有更现代的API,但在一些简单场景下仍然实用。通过绝对路径或相对路径创建File对象后,可以调用exists()检查文件是否存在,length()获取文件大小等。二...
作者:admin 日期:2025.06.27 分类:Java安全 19 -
彻底掌握Java基本数据类型:从底层原理到性能优化全解析
在Java编程语言中,基本数据类型是构建程序的基础元素。与引用类型不同,基本数据类型直接存储值而非引用,这使得它们在内存使用和访问效率上具有显著优势。本文将全面剖析Java的8种基本数据类型,帮助开发者深入理解其特性并掌握高效使用技巧。一、Java基本数据类型概述 Java语言规范定义了8种基本数据类型,可分为4大类: 整型:byte、short、int、long 浮点型:float、double 字符型:char 布尔型:boolean 这些类型都有固定的内存大小和取值范...
作者:admin 日期:2025.06.27 分类:Java安全 19 -
Java编译命令全解析:从基础javac到高级优化技巧
Java作为一门编译型语言,编译是将源代码转换为可执行程序的关键步骤。本文将全面解析Java编译命令,从基础用法到高级技巧,帮助开发者提升编译效率和质量。一、Java编译基础:javac命令javac是JDK中最基本的编译命令,其基本语法为:javac [options] [sourcefiles] 1.1 最简单的编译示例javac HelloWorld.java 这会将Java源文件编译为同名的.class文件。1.2 编译多个文件 可以同时编译多个.java文件:j...
作者:admin 日期:2025.06.27 分类:Java安全 19 -
Java代码执行顺序全解析:类加载、变量初始化与构造方法的秘密
在Java编程中,理解代码的执行顺序是深入掌握这门语言的基础。本文将全面解析Java程序从加载到执行的完整生命周期,帮助开发者避免因执行顺序不当导致的逻辑错误。一、类加载阶段(Class Loading) Java程序的执行始于类加载,这是由JVM的类加载子系统完成的。类加载过程遵循严格的顺序: 加载(Loading):查找并加载类的二进制数据 验证(Verification):确保类文件的正确性和安全性 准备(Preparation):为静态变量分配内存并设置默认值 解析(...
作者:admin 日期:2025.06.27 分类:Java安全 20